October is National Pork Month, and to celebrate, this week’s featured recipe showcases this popular protein with three different types of pork rolled up into one delicious Triple Pork Stuffed Pork Tenderloin. This dish is deceptively elegant, and you can recreate this beautiful presentation right in your own kitchen using a sharp knife, a large cutting board, plastic wrap, kitchen twine and a meat mallet. 31 Days of Healthy Deliciousness, Day 6: Jamaican Jerk Pork Tenderloin with Pineapple Salsa

We have an arsenal of recipes that have been created as a direct result of our regionally-imposed vitamin D deficiency, and they never fail to lift our spirits or bring a little sunshine into our lives, especially in January. Today’s Jamaican Jerk Pork Tenderloin with Pineapple Salsa is no exception. With much of the prep work done in advance, this pork dish makes for an easy, delicious and healthy weeknight dinner.
